LASIK stands for Laser Assisted In Situ Keratomileusis. It is a surgical procedure that reshapes the cornea using state of the art lasers so that light entering the eye focuses more precisely on the retina. This correction can improve or even eliminate reliance on glasses or contact lenses. ClearSight offers **All-Laser LASIK**, meaning both the flap creation and the corneal remodeling are done with laser technology rather than blades. To get the best results with LASIK you need fairly healthy eyes. ClearSight requires patients to be at least eighteen years old. Corneal thickness, pupil size, the stability of vision prescription matter. If your corneas are too thin or you have certain irregularities or eye conditions, they may recommend alternate procedures like SMILE LASIK, ASA (advanced PRK), EVO ICL, or custom lens replacement.

People who wear glasses or contacts and want more freedom or who struggle with the cost and inconvenience of lenses often benefit the most. Lifestyle factors such as frequent travel, active sports, or work under glare or bright lights often push people toward choosing LASIK.
